Obituary for Raymond John Little Jr.
Peoria- Raymond John Little, Jr., 86, of Peoria, Illinois, formerly of Peoria Heights, Illinois, passed away October 3, 2017, at Lutheran Hillside Village.
Raymond was born on August 30, 1931 in Peoria, to Raymond and Frances (Buck) Little. He attended Sacred Heart Grade School, Woodruff High School and WVCC, where he earned a degree in automotive operational safety.
He married Betty Larke on July 7, 1951. She survives. They danced together for sixty-six years. Together they had five children, Amy (John) Kelly, Jody (Keith) Kamin, Timothy (Kay) Little, Beth (Andy) Casten, and Suzette Rae Kennedy, who preceded him in death. Also preceding him in death were his parents and one granddaughter, Tessa Casten. Ray and Betty lovingly and loyally cared for Suzette’s daughter, Janice Kennedy, for the last thirty-four years. Also surviving are eight grandchildren, four great-grandchildren, four step grandchildren and four step-great-grandchildren. His brothers, Hobart (Jean) and Paul (Nancy), along with his sisters, Betty (Dave) Svymbersky and Paula (Rick) Gall survive him as well.
Ray worked for forty years at CILCO and Ameren, starting as a lineman and finishing as a supervisor. A great many lifelong friendships were established during his tenure.
He was a member of St. Jude Knights of Columbus and St. Thomas parish.
He enjoyed golf, bowling, fishing. And had a passion for the outdoors and in particular pheasant hunting. He was devoted to family and friends, was selfless with his time, love and loyalty.
